Are these mental health services free?
Most listings on OneClickMentalHealth are free or low-cost. Each resource page shows pricing or fee structure when known. Many providers offer sliding-scale fees based on income, accept Medicaid, or are funded by federal, state, or county programs.
How do I know if I'm eligible?
Eligibility varies by provider — common factors include income, insurance, residency, age, and the type of service needed. Call the listed phone number; most intake staff can tell you in a few minutes whether you qualify and what to bring.
What if I'm in crisis right now?
If you or someone you love is in immediate danger, call 911. For mental health emergencies, call or text 988 — the Suicide & Crisis Lifeline — for free, 24/7, confidential support in English and Spanish (Spanish: press 2). Veterans can press 1.
Do these services accept insurance or Medicaid?
Many do. Open any resource page to see accepted insurance plans when reported, or call to confirm. If you don't have insurance, ask about sliding-scale fees, charity care, or county-funded programs — many providers serve uninsured patients.
